Obelisk, (sculpture).
Artist:
de Cuevas, Elizabeth, 1929- , sculptor.
Tallix, founder.
Title:
Obelisk, (sculpture).
Other Titles:
Obelisk Head, (sculpture).
Dates:
1983. Copyrighted 1983.
Medium:
Sculpture: bronze with stainless steel eye; Base: steel, painted black.
Dimensions:
Sculpture: approx. 7 x 3 1/2 x 2 1/2 ft.; Base: approx. 7 x 40 x 40 in.
Inscription:
(Artist's monogram of a joined "C" and "S") 1/3 (copyright symbol) 1983 (Founder's mark of a "T" on top of an "X" appears) signed Founder's mark appears.
Description:
Abstract face consists of a proper left eye, nose and open mouth.
Subject:
Abstract
Figure -- Fragment -- Face
Object Type:
Outdoor Sculpture -- Connecticut -- Greenwich
Sculpture
Owner:
Bruce Museum, Museum Drive, Greenwich, Connecticut 06830
Remarks:
Cast no. 1/3. The sculpture was located in front of a gallery in Binghampton, New York at time of 1994 SOS! survey.
